Screens and Details Leak from ‘Dark Souls 3’

A batch of screenshots and some intriguing gameplay details have leaked from Dark Souls 3 about two weeks ahead of its official unveiling at E3.

The leak comes from a YouTube channel called The Know, which claims to have inside knowledge and our first look at the upcoming game. Bandai Namco has yet to confirm any of this, but in my opinion, this looks legit.

According to the video below, Dark Souls 3 will again support 1-4 players when it arrives on the PS4 and Xbox One in 2016. A PC release is “negotiable”, whatever that means. The game will also introduce bosses that can “heat up” and change to different forms and now players can sacrifice enemies to invade another player’s world.

Assuming all of the above is true, Dark Souls 3 is shaping up to be a worthy follow-up to the very good Dark Souls 2 (review). This series has only gotten better since it began with Demon’s Souls in 2009, so I can’t say that I’m too nervous about this one.

The real question is whether it’ll be as refreshing as Bloodborne (review) was, with its darker setting and streamlined take on the Dark Souls formula.
